  I don't know there is a good way to do that by ouvrebyte 2003-01-13 12:45:35
But some obvious things:

1. Don't lie. You might not feel comfortable telling your boss that you have an interview, but that doesn't mean you have to tell an untruth. Try, "I need some extra time for lunch so I can take care of a personal errand." Or arrange your interviews to be in the evening.

2. If you get offered another job, talk to your boss before you accept it. Who knows, maybe they really could match a better salary you've been offered. And if not, they can't say they weren't given the opportunity to do a little better for you.

3. Give notice, and do your job during the notice period. Offer to help train your replacement.

That's about as much as you can do, and if your current employers are as cool as you say, that should be enough.
